Hermes was a Greek god and one of the Twelve Olympians who lived on Mount Olympus. His main job was to serve as the messenger of the gods. He was actually the son of Mother Earth and created the first life on Earth with Gaea. Uranus married his mother and had 18 children with her. The Titans were the most important children of Uranus and Gaea.
